Florida Governor Charlie Crist Joins Us for Coffee

With St. Petersburg Honorable Rick Baker, my husband Phil and I co-hosted a coffee reception for Florida Governor Charlie Crist on Saturday, February 6, 2010. The crisp, clear morning weather lit up our great room, and our guest of honor lit up the conversation.

We also enjoyed our time with newly-elected Mayor of St. Petersburg, Bill Foster.

A 60 Minutes film crew captured the event; can’t wait to see that segment!

Governor Crist met with Reverend Moses Brown of Feed Our Children Ministries and the girls recently brought here from Haiti.
Of course, everyone was interested in the plans for Florida’s economic recovery. Our involvement with the 2010 Real Economic Impact Tour (REI Tour) has us participating with diverse partners in national economic recovery efforts for consumers. And my November, 2009, participation in Governor Christ’s Florida Small Business Summit with its theme, Road to a Brighter Future, had informed me of areas of concern, such as The Unique Challenges of
Florida’s Small Businesses, Florida’s Economic Gardening Program, Cutting Red Tape for Florida’s Small Businesses, Finding Strength in Numbers, and Connecting Small Business Owners with Florida’s Workforce. Everyone at the reception was interested in Governor Crist’s evolving vision for Florida’s small businesses and citizens as we build a path to greater prosperity.
